
Google has pushed out Chrome version 151, a major update that addresses a staggering 370 security vulnerabilities. Among these, seven have been classified as critical, meaning attackers could exploit them to take full control of a user's system. The update is available for Windows, macOS, and Linux.
The seven critical vulnerabilities largely stem from memory safety issues, a common attack vector in browsers. Google's security team has not released technical specifics for most bugs, a standard move to give users time to patch before attackers reverse-engineer the fixes.
The update also includes patches for high-severity issues related to use-after-free errors, buffer overflows, and improper input validation. These flaws could allow remote code execution or data theft if left unaddressed.
India's Computer Emergency Response Team (CERT-In) has issued a high-severity advisory for Chrome users across Windows, macOS, and Linux. The agency warned that the vulnerabilities could allow an attacker to compromise the targeted system.
CERT-In has recommended that users update their Chrome browser to version 151 immediately. The advisory is part of the agency's ongoing effort to track and mitigate cyber threats targeting Indian internet users.
Users can update their browser by navigating to the menu (three dots in the top-right corner), selecting Help, and then About Google Chrome. The browser will automatically check for and install the latest update. A relaunch is required to complete the process.
Enterprise administrators should ensure that managed devices receive the update through their deployment systems. Google has also updated the Stable channel for ChromeOS and Android users, though those platforms may have a slightly different patch set.
